Methadone is a drug utilized for the treatment of opiate addiction and dependency. Someone who wants to quit using prescription pain killers or heroin can get started on a methadone clinic in or near Old Westbury where they ingest it on a daily basis to avoid withdrawal symptoms, avoid cravings and basically substitute their addiction with a legal medication. Many individuals who begin methadone maintenance remain on the drug for many years, due to the fact that withdrawing off it causes withdrawal symptoms much worse than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, just like heroin. However, it remains in the body longer which is why the withdrawal from it can be so painful and last so long. And considering methadone can stay in the body for such a long time, users usually will not even start feeling the effects of withdrawal for a day or two when they stop taking it cold turkey. Methadone withdrawal is like that of other opiates, and feels similar to a really bad flu which can include fever, chills,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, acute insomnia, etc.

Methadone detoxification can be made much more comfortable in a professional detoxification facility which accepts methadone clients. Some programs provide a medically managed detox while others help the client get off the drug cold turkey without any medications.
